固相萃取分离-气相色谱-质谱法测定尿中18种邻苯二甲酸酯类增塑剂
GC-MS Determination of 18 Phthalates in Urine with Separation by Solid-Phase Extraction
-
摘要: 在尿样中加入混合同位素内标(D4-DBP和D4-DEHP)后,使之通过自制的SPE柱(取LC-C18填料,Envi-carb填料和PSA填料装入于玻璃柱中,用旋涡混合器使之混匀)对尿样中存在的邻苯二甲酯类化合物(PTA′s)进行SPE。SPE柱用正己烷-乙酸乙酯(1+1)混合液洗脱。用DB-5MS毛细管柱进行色谱分离,质谱分析中采用EI离子源和SIM模式进行测定,所测18种PTA′s在一定质量浓度范围内与峰面积呈线性关系,检出限(3S/N)在0.002 5~0.005 mg·kg-1之间。加标回收率在80.0%~120%之间,测定值的相对标准偏差(n=6)在2.5%~14%之间。Abstract: Eighteen phthalates (PTA′s) in urine were separated on a self-made SPE column made by packing a glass column with fillers of LC-C18, Envi-carb and PSA and mixing with a swirling mixer. Mixed istopic PTA′s (i.e. D4-DBP and D4-DEHP) were added as internal standards. After passing the urine sample through the SPE column, the column was eluted with n-hexane-ethylacetate (1+1) mixture. DB-5MS capillary column was used for chromatographic separation, and EI as well as SIM mode was adopted in MS analysis. Linear relationships between values of peak area and mass concentration were obtained in definite ranges with values of DL (3S/N) ranged from 0.002 5 to 0.005 mg·kg-1. Values of recovery found by standard addition method were in the range of 80.0%-120%, with RSD′s (n=6) ranged from 2.5% to 14%.
